Description

A covered bridge is the entrance to Mills Riverside Park. There is an amazing view of Mount Mansfield from the beginning paths before going into the woods. Also in the fields before entering the woods, there is a pond and pavilion. You can find benches periodically along the path, several of which offer lovely views of Mt. Mansfield and some very interesting trees. Dense summertime foliage offers cool temperatures and shade from the sun. In the spring, the trail may have very muddy spots and many fallen trees.

Mountain bikers would find the trail of medium difficulty. There are three loops that can be followed separately or combined enabling you to tailor your ride to a specific difficulty level or time constraint.

Other Information

Posted Rules:

  • Park is open from dawn to dusk
  • No motorized vehicles past covered bridge
  • Dogs must be leashed at all times except for designated "off leash" areas
  • Fishing is allowed in pond and river
  • No hunting, trapping, or firearms
  • Remain on designated trails
  • All trash carry in, carry out
  • Need special permits for: fires and/or camping, private events at the Pavilion, large gatherings of 50 or more people
  • During Mud Season bikes and horses are not permitted until May 20th
